Output d56b1ea15b204bb390ea8f28e16c90afd07867b5271c7c7e4441fbe5923b9558:0

value
59046382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c53f66cfa760bee25a47e70df5c2a307e4207a OP_EQUAL
address
33aqjPUDtutMHfami2TVGbyqH2hmJiWxMy
transaction
d56b1ea15b204bb390ea8f28e16c90afd07867b5271c7c7e4441fbe5923b9558
spent
true